TIA issues Three New TDMA Third Generation Wireless Standards

Arlington, VA (September 11, 2014) – The Telecommunications Industry Association, which develops standards for the information and communications technology industry, has released three new parts of the TDMA 3G interoperability suite of standards. 

The following parts incorporate support for 3GPP GERAN Release 9 and also include support for Overload class 12 as per TSB-16-B

TIA/EIA-136-000-I, TDMA Third General Wireless List of Parts

TIA/EIA-136-123-I, TDMA Third Generation Wireless Digital Control Channel Layer 3

TIA/EIA-136-140-C, TDMA Third Generation Wireless - Analog Control Channel

TIA/EIA-136 was formulated under the cognizance of the TIA TR-45 Mobile and Point-to-Point Communications Standards, TR-45.3 Time Division Digital Technology - Mobile and Personal Communications Standards subcommittee.
